Yes, but not in the 60's. The Caprice hardtop back then had a noticeable different roof line, interior upholstery was unique, as well as the center operating instrument console had the addition of of a MAP gauge, and the clock was in a pod at the center atop of the dash. Also, the rear tail lights had a chrome grid over them. However, not to say there wasn't a COPO out there somewhere.
